Home Prices in Bristow, VA
The median home value in Bristow, VA is $747,849 as of mid-2026, according to Zillow's Home Value Index (ZHVI).That's up 1.3% compared to a year ago and up 3.4% from two years prior.
Compared to the U.S. national median of $410,000, homes in Bristow are priced82% above average. Bristow is part of the Washington-Arlington-Alexandria, DC-VA-MD-WV metro area.
Over the past five years, Bristow home values have risen by approximately27.7%, reflecting strong long-term appreciation in this market.

Affordability
What Does It Cost to Buy in Bristow?
20% Down Payment
$149,570
on $747,849
Monthly P&I
$3,900/mo
30-yr @ 6.8%
Total Monthly Est.
~$4,953/mo
incl. taxes & insurance
Income Needed
$198,120
gross annual (30% rule)
10% Down Option
$74,785
+ PMI applies
Loan Amount (20% dn)
$598,279
at current rates
Estimates assume a 30-year fixed mortgage at 6.8%. Monthly total includes estimated property taxes and homeowner's insurance. Actual costs vary.
